                  Re: Official PS2/Xbox Bugs, Glitches Thread

                  Update on this:

                  Pitcher's fatigue in played franchise games is STILL broken from last year. The same bug! How could they have not fixed this bug that was in 2K5? I started a franchise and I played my first game with Eric Bedard pitching. I purposefully had him pitch the whole game and lost 5-0. He did have fatigue throughout the game. By the ninth inning he was at 0% endurance. I then started another game and went to choose my starting pitcher and Bedard had 100% endurance. I chose Bedard to pitch again and he was at 100% starting the 1st inning. I simulated the rest of the game and started to play the 3rd game and Bedard's endurance was at 38%. So, my conclusion is that pitcher's fatigue in played franchise games is STILL broken. Ridiculous. I hope they are alerted this before the release the 360 version. I was very hyped for this game and can overlook many small problems but this is a game killer for me.

                  This is the update:

                  I tried playing a GM franchise game and the pitcher fatigue worked. THe only time it does not work is when you select franchise and then select a season that is less than 162 games. This is HUGE for me because I do not like to play out the whole season.
